Generator-maintenance scheduling using simplified frequency-and duration-reliability criteria

Abstract
The paper proposes a technique for scheduling generation maintenance based on the frequency and duration method for reliability evaluation of power systems. The method permits the weekly risk created by removing units from service to be minimised and allows all practical constraints imposed on the system to be included, and, if necessary, continuously updated. In order to maintain high computational efficiency, a new approximate technique applied to the frequency and duration method is proposed and the errors introduced by it are assessed. Finally, a typical generating system is analysed to illustrate the generation-scheduling technique and the results are discussed.
